在北京这个互联网产业高度集中的城市,企业对于定制开发服务的需求日益增长,但如何在众多选项中做出最优选择,成为许多企业管理者面临的难题。本文将从成本与效率两个核心维度出发,梳理5个关键决策点,帮助企业在小程序开发、网站开发或软件开发项目中实现投入产出比最大化。
1. 明确需求边界,避免隐性成本膨胀
1.1 需求文档的颗粒度决定成本基准
许多企业在启动定制开发项目时,仅提供模糊的需求描述,这会导致开发过程中频繁变更,直接推高成本。专业的开发公司通常会要求企业提供详细的需求文档,包括功能清单、用户流程、界面原型等。多点互动公司建议企业在需求阶段就邀请专业团队参与评估,通过服务中的需求梳理模块,帮助企业明确核心功能,减少后期变更带来的成本增加。
1.2 区分“必须功能”与“期望功能”
企业应将需求分为“必须实现”和“期望实现”两类,优先开发核心功能,后期再根据业务发展迭代升级。这种分阶段开发的方式不仅能降低初始投入成本,还能让产品更快上线验证市场,提升整体效率。
2. 评估开发公司的效率指标,而非仅看报价
2.1 交付周期的历史数据验证
选择开发公司时,不应只关注报价,更要考察其历史项目的交付周期。可以要求开发公司提供类似项目的案例,查看其是否能在承诺时间内完成开发。多点互动公司在作品展示中提供了多个按时交付的成功案例,证明其在效率控制方面的实力。
2.2 团队配置与技术栈匹配度
高效的开发团队应具备合理的人员配置,包括产品经理、UI设计师、前端开发、后端开发、测试工程师等。同时,技术栈的选择也直接影响开发效率,企业应确保开发公司使用的技术栈与项目需求相匹配,避免因技术不熟练导致的进度延误。
3. 成本结构透明化,规避隐藏费用
3.1 明确报价包含的服务范围
企业在与开发公司签订合同前,应仔细核对报价单,明确各项费用的构成,包括需求分析、设计、开发、测试、部署、培训等。特别要注意是否包含后期维护费用,以及维护期限和范围。
3.2 变更管理机制的约定
项目开发过程中难免会有需求变更,企业应与开发公司约定变更管理机制,明确变更的审批流程和费用计算方式,避免因变更导致成本失控。
4. 效率导向的合作模式选择
4.1 敏捷开发 vs 瀑布开发的成本效率对比
敏捷开发通过迭代式开发和快速反馈,能有效降低项目风险,提升开发效率,特别适合需求不确定的项目。而瀑布开发则更适合需求明确、流程固定的项目。企业应根据自身项目特点选择合适的开发模式。
4.2 驻场开发 vs 远程协作的适用性分析
驻场开发能加强沟通效率,但成本较高;远程协作则能降低人力成本,但对沟通机制要求更高。企业应根据项目复杂度和预算情况选择合适的合作模式。
5. 长期价值考量:维护与迭代成本
5.1 源代码所有权与二次开发权限
企业应确保在合同中明确源代码的所有权归属,以及是否拥有二次开发权限。这关系到产品未来的迭代成本和灵活性。
5.2 售后服务响应速度与成本
选择开发公司时,要考察其售后服务体系,包括响应时间、解决问题的能力和费用标准。良好的售后服务能降低产品上线后的维护成本,提升用户体验。
总结
北京企业在选择定制开发服务时,应综合考虑成本与效率两个维度,从需求明确、开发公司评估、成本结构、合作模式和长期价值五个方面做出决策。多点互动公司作为北京专业的软件开发服务提供商,通过科学的项目管理流程和专业的技术团队,帮助企业在小程序开发、网站开发等项目中实现成本控制与效率提升的平衡。企业可通过联系我们获取定制开发方案,开启高效的数字化转型之旅。